The Great Wall by Nicole Gifford author info Strutting along your wall Between “Good” And “Not good” You trip over your efforts Grasping in a flailing panic Of which side you’ll fall. Your hands grip tightly to “Not good” While your feet dangle desperately Into “Good”. Strong enough To pull yourself up You stand with your hands On your hips Head high, chest lifted Surveying the lands on both sides Like a superhero of non-committal. |
